Woman Unknown

Watch her walk woman of the unknown
Leather boots heels on fire
Painted face lips powted red
A woman of confidence
A look that you desire 
Her hips swing as they cross your path
Her dancing curls tempt your wants
Your thoughts drive you too wild to define
Inside your dream of seduction unfolds
Outside you stare with pounding veins
Rose petals to her feet
Sweet breathes to her smile
Perfumed swept trail surrounds your senses
She has a light that sends her to the rainbow edge
Colours from her aura as an easel is left
Her vision is an artists making
She does not know that you feel her spirit
Her soul is crawling to your hand 
Your fingertips think of a touch of such delight
Of the woman unknown
